Pre-filled AI links weaponized to poison assistant memory

Marketing sites embed hidden prompt injections in 'Ask AI' buttons, silently altering how commercial assistants respond to users without malware or credentials.

A new attack vector is exploiting a feature common to nearly every major AI assistant: pre-filled deep links that auto-populate prompts when clicked. Security researchers have identified production websites embedding hidden prompt injection payloads inside 'Ask AI' buttons on marketing and competitor comparison pages.

The technique requires no malware, no stolen credentials, and no software vulnerability. Instead, it abuses the standard mechanism by which websites offer users a shortcut to query an AI assistant about a product or service. When a user clicks the button, the hidden payload is silently appended to the prompt, altering the assistant's behavior or memory without the user's knowledge.

The attack is notable because it operates entirely within the intended functionality of AI assistants. Pre-filled links are designed to improve user experience by reducing friction. Vendors including OpenAI, Anthropic, Google, and Microsoft all support variants of this feature. The injection occurs client-side, making it invisible to the user and difficult to detect through conventional security controls.

Implications
  • 01Enterprises using AI assistants face invisible influence over employee research and procurement decisions.
  • 02AI vendors must redesign deep-link mechanisms or implement server-side payload inspection.
  • 03Marketing and comparison sites become high-value targets for competitors seeking to manipulate recommendations.
